function evaluateArguments(template: string, input: string) {
const args = parseArguments(input)
const placeholders = template.match(placeholderRegex) ?? []
const last = Math.max(0, ...placeholders.map((item) => Number(item.slice(1))))
const expanded = template.replaceAll(placeholderRegex, (_, index) => {
const position = Number(index)
const argIndex = position - 1
if (argIndex >= args.length) return ""
if (position === last) return args.slice(argIndex).join(" ")
return args[argIndex]
})
const withArguments = expanded.replaceAll("$ARGUMENTS", input)
if (placeholders.length === 0 && !template.includes("$ARGUMENTS") && input.trim()) return `${withArguments}\n\n${input}`.trim()
return withArguments.trim()
}

function parseArguments(input: string) {
return (input.match(argsRegex) ?? []).map((arg) => arg.replace(quoteTrimRegex, ""))
}
function promptMessageText(content: unknown) {
if (typeof content === "string") return content
if (!content || typeof content !== "object") return ""
if (!("type" in content) || content.type !== "text") return ""
if (!("text" in content) || typeof content.text !== "string") return ""
return content.text
}
function mcpCommandName(server: string, prompt: string) {
return `${sanitize(server)}:${sanitize(prompt)}`
}
function sanitize(value: string) {
return value.replace(/[^a-zA-Z0-9_-]/g, "_")
}
const argsRegex = /(?:\[Image\s+\d+\]|"[^"]*"|'[^']*'|[^\s"']+)/gi
const placeholderRegex = /\$(\d+)/g
const quoteTrimRegex = /^["']|["']$/g
const shellRegex = /!`([^`]+)`/g
